The trick to getting a finer thread with a only having the standard gears would be a multiple start thread just like you do a 3 or 4 start spiral it would be a very fast 2 inch pitch but like 4 starts thus keeping the tread depth smaller. But you really need the .25 reduction gear set Witch I t
